Precautions for car child safety locks: The car child safety lock is a feature designed to prevent children from accidentally opening the car door, thereby avoiding harm to children. Typically, child locks are located on the two rear doors. When the child lock function is activated, the rear doors cannot be opened from the inside but can be opened from the outside. Two types of child safety locks: There are two common types of child safety lock switches: one is a rotary knob type, and the other is a toggle switch type. Since the rotary knob type child safety lock requires a key (or key-like object) to be inserted into the corresponding hole to turn the knob switch for locking and unlocking, the toggle switch type child safety lock is more convenient to use in comparison.
